What is the function of a tube atmosphere furnace in CMK-3 carbonization? Master Precise Mesoporous Synthesis


The tube atmosphere furnace acts as the indispensable thermal reactor for CMK-3 synthesis. It provides the high-temperature environment—typically 877 °C—and the inert nitrogen flow required to convert sucrose precursors into carbon. This setup ensures that carbonization occurs deep within the pores of the SBA-15 template while preventing the material from burning.

The primary function of a tube atmosphere furnace is to provide an oxygen-free, high-temperature environment that enables the pyrolysis of precursors into a structured carbon framework. By shielding the material from oxygen, the furnace prevents combustion and preserves the intricate mesoporous architecture essential for CMK-3.

The Mechanics of Carbonization in CMK-3 Synthesis

Precision Temperature Regulation

The furnace maintains a steady environment, often calibrated to 877 °C, which is the threshold necessary for sucrose precursors to undergo complete carbonization. This level of control ensures the resulting carbon framework achieves the high electrical conductivity required for advanced applications.

Facilitating Pyrolysis over Combustion

Without the furnace's controlled environment, the organic precursors would undergo oxidative combustion (burning) rather than chemical transformation. The furnace allows for pyrolysis, a process where organic materials decompose thermally in the absence of oxygen to form stable, solid carbon structures.

Directing Growth within the Template

The furnace provides the thermal energy required to drive the precursor into the nano-channels of the SBA-15 silica template. This ensures that the carbonization process replicates the template's structure, resulting in a well-preserved mesoporous framework.

The Vital Role of Atmosphere Control

Inert Gas Shielding

A continuous flow of nitrogen (N2) or argon is introduced into the furnace tube to displace all atmospheric oxygen. This inert atmosphere is critical to prevent the oxidative loss of the carbon material, which would otherwise vanish as carbon dioxide at such high temperatures.

Elimination of Non-Carbon Elements

As the furnace heats the precursor, the controlled atmosphere facilitates the thermal decomposition and removal of non-carbon elements (like oxygen and hydrogen). This leaves behind a pure carbon skeleton while preventing any unwanted chemical reactions with the surrounding air.

Preserving Structural Integrity

The furnace's ability to maintain a stable, oxygen-free state is essential for preserving the structural stability of the material. This ensures that the final CMK-3 product retains a high specific surface area and an ordered pore distribution.

Understanding the Trade-offs

Sealing Integrity and Contamination

If the tube furnace is not perfectly sealed, even trace amounts of oxygen can lead to partial oxidation of the carbon framework. This results in a lower specific surface area and a significant loss of structural uniformity in the final CMK-3 product.

Heating Rate Sensitivity

The rate at which the furnace reaches its target temperature (the "ramp rate") is vital for the gradual decomposition of the precursor. Heating too quickly can cause rapid gas evolution within the pores, which may fracture the mesoporous skeleton and degrade the material's quality.

Gas Flow Consistency

While nitrogen flow is necessary to remove byproduct gases, excessive flow rates can lead to temperature fluctuations within the tube. Conversely, insufficient flow may allow decomposition byproducts to linger, potentially contaminating the carbon surface and reducing its purity.

How to Apply This to Your Project

To achieve a high-quality CMK-3 mesoporous carbon, the operation of the tube furnace must align with your specific material goals.

  • If your primary focus is high specific surface area: Ensure the furnace maintains a strictly oxygen-free environment and perfect sealing to prevent any "burning off" of the delicate carbon walls.
  • If your primary focus is structural order: Utilize a precise, slow heating ramp-up to allow precursors to decompose gradually within the SBA-15 template pores without structural stress.
  • If your primary focus is electrical conductivity: Maintain the high-temperature plateau, such as 877 °C, with high precision to ensure complete carbonization and the development of a stable carbon framework.

The tube atmosphere furnace is the cornerstone of CMK-3 synthesis, transforming raw precursors into a sophisticated carbon architecture through the precise mastery of heat and atmosphere.
